New Bern, NC (August 25, 2026) – TITAN Aviation Fuels is proud to announce an exclusive partnership with AERO Specialties, a global leader in aviation ground support equipment (GSE) solutions and member of the Alvest Group.

Together, the two companies are launching the TITAN Preferred GSE Program powered by AERO
Specialties, a new initiative designed to bring meaningful operational advantages and exclusive benefits
to TITAN-branded FBO locations across the network.

The partnership brings together two respected aviation industry brands with a shared commitment to
service, reliability, innovation, and long-term customer relationships. Through the program, participating
TITAN Network FBOs will gain access to preferred pricing, global service and support resources,
operational training, fleet optimization expertise, and advanced GSE technology solutions designed to improve operational efficiency and reduce downtime at TITAN FBOs. Ultimately, this elevates and expedites service delivery to flight departments and aircraft operators during arrivals and departures.

As part of the TITAN Preferred GSE Program, participating FBOs will receive access to:

  • Preferred pricing on GSE equipment and OEM parts
  • Streamlined sourcing and procurement support
  • Global maintenance and service capabilities
  • Operations and maintenance training programs
  • Flexible financing and leasing options
  • LINK® telemetry and smart equipment insights
  • Fleet standardization and optimization consulting
  • Access to electric GSE and sustainability-focused solutions

The program is designed to help FBO operators improve equipment reliability, increase operational efficiency, and lower total cost of ownership while continuing to elevate the overall value of the TITAN
network.

The TITAN Preferred GSE Program will roll out across TITAN’s network of more than 675 branded FBO locations worldwide.

TITAN Aviation Fuels is a leading global supplier of aviation fuel with a network of more than 675
branded FBO locations. In addition to providing a secure supply of aviation fuels for global flight
departments and FBOs, TITAN offers a full array of support services including TITAN Rewards, a pilot
loyalty program, aviation card processing solutions – including the Multi Service® Aviation (MSA) Card
powered by TITAN, TITAN aviation insurance, quality control training, ATLAS FBO Management
Software, equipment leasing and financing, an online aviation parts store, and a customer-focused mobile
application.

TITAN’s Carbon Offsets Program Summary

  • New technology, infrastructure, operational improvements, and sustainable aviation fuels (SAF) will not eliminate carbon emissions immediately or completely.
  • The aviation industry is looking for ways to meet sustainability standards and regulations.  
  • Aviation businesses can neutralize their fuel emissions with the TITAN Aviation Fuels Carbon Offsets Program.
  • Showcase your businesses’ environmental leadership by supporting US based sustainable projects that meet the industry’s highest standards.
  • TITAN Aviation Fuels Carbon Offsets Program provides a simple opt-in solution that can be added to your fuel invoice.

What Documentation is Provided?

Your purchase of Carbon Offsets are confirmed with an email that includes details of the transaction and a Certificate of Sustainability.

How Are Emissions Reduced Through Carbon Offsets?

Your Flight Department opts-in to our Carbon Offsets Program and TITAN adds the cost of the Carbon Offsets to your fuel invoice

TITAN enters fuel purchase amount (in gallons) into TITAN’s Carbon Offsets enrollment page 

Carbon Offsets are retired on behalf of your Flight Department and an email confirmation and Certificate of Sustainability is sent for your records

How Are Emissions Reduced Through Carbon Offsets?

1. Measure

For any organization to manage the impact of its greenhouse gas emissions, it must first quantify them

2. Reduce

Identify and act on areas where your organization can reduce its overall impact on the environment through everyday measures.

3. Offset

Purchase Carbon Offsets to counter the remaining unavoidable emissions.
